Merci

Media and Event production via Resilient Communication on IoT Infrastructure

Media and Event production via Resilient Communication on IoT Infrastructure (MERCI) is a government-funded Franco-German joint research project. By involving companies from the Industrial IoT (IIoT) and PMSE sectors, the project forms a collaborative R&D ecosystem for private 5G networks based on or complemented by DECT NR+. MERCI follows the shared vision of creating fully immersive audio-visual experiences through NR+ cooperative networks that advantageously integrate nomadic PMSE devices into on-premises IoT infrastructure. Aiming at a practical, application-oriented evaluation and demonstration of NR+, the project helps evolve the technology to meet industry demand for “made in Europe” private network infrastructure, data sovereignty and economic independence.

Funding program

Federal Ministry for Economic Affairs and Climate Protection (BMWK), program “Franco-German Ecosystem for Private 5G Networks”
